Output f6bb943de517a8f607f6830f3c87d7969e7571cefabcc676f180d643458dce91:1

value
1923614
script pubkey
OP_0 OP_PUSHBYTES_20 4ff80312637ce316414d26886f8d7c47eb5393a7
address
bc1qfluqxynr0n33vs2dy6yxlrtugl448ya854mw2d
transaction
f6bb943de517a8f607f6830f3c87d7969e7571cefabcc676f180d643458dce91
confirmations
171966
spent
true